Notes

Brew Date -1/22/21

Finally, I hit the numbers and the results didn't disappoint.

I added 8oz of DME because I had it, I normally wouldn't add extract to my all-grain brew. It was accounted for in the actual results below. I will delete it from the recipe.

UPDATE - 2/7/21 - Racked into glass. SG @ 1.008, already at 86% attenuation. Will lager 4-6 weeks @ 33-34 degrees.

UPDATE - 4/10/21 - SG remained at 1.008. Racked into keg with no sugar and kept cold. I figure if I'm not adding sugar I don't need to bring up the temp.
Will return to tried and true method of forced carbonation. Burp, increase Psi to 30lb, shake and roll around on the ground for a few minutes. Let sit for 72 hours. Decrease psi to under 10lbs and release excess Co2. Pour.

ACTUAL RESULTS:

Total water: 9 gals - perfect for this one
Pre-boil volume: 7.5 - 7.75 gals
Ending kettle volume: 6.25 - 6.5 gallons
Fermenter volume: 6.1 gals
Boil time: 90 min
Efficiency: 83% !!!
OG: 1.060
FG: 1.008
ABV: 6.8%
Attenuation: 86%
IBU's: 16
SRM: 3.4
